The term alternative service refers to the delivery of legal documents through non-traditional methods, like through a third party. Alternative service, in contrast to traditional methods, is a formal process that informs parties about forthcoming court appearances. Alternative service may be performed by a legal professional in the event that a person is unable to receive the documents personally. To ensure that the service is performed correctly, it is essential that you follow all court regulations and timelines.

Alternative methods of service include the publication of the summons, complaint, sending the papers directly to defendant's address of last contact or posting the documents to specific locations. In some instances the process of service by other methods won't be legally recognized until the document has been sent. In such a situation, the service may result in the dismissal of the case or a re-start.

Alternative methods of service can be an option if traditional methods of service are not viable. In these cases the plaintiff has to submit a formal motion for alternative service, and show diligence on the part of the process server. A motion for alternate service must demonstrate that the plaintiff was able to serve the defendant. In addition, the judge will decide whether the alternative is acceptable.
